แชร์ผ่าน


กำหนดค่าแมโครเพื่อปรับปรุงประสิทธิภาพการทำงานของเจ้าหน้าที่

หมายเหตุ

ข้อมูลความพร้อมใช้งานของคุณลักษณะมีดังนี้

Dynamics 365 Contact Center—แบบฝัง Dynamics 365 Contact Center—แบบสแตนด์อโลน Dynamics 365 Customer Service
ไม่ ใช่ ใช่

ในอุตสาหกรรมการบริการลูกค้า เจ้าหน้าที่ต้องคลิกบ่อยครั้งเพื่อทำงานง่ายๆ เช่น เปิดแบบฟอร์ม กรอกและบันทึกข้อมูล และการดำเนินการซ้ำๆ และจำเจ เช่น การทักทายและการยืนยันลูกค้า การส่งจดหมายตอบรับ และการจดบันทึก การคลิกและงานซ้ำๆ เหล่านี้อาจนำไปสู่ข้อผิดพลาดของมนุษย์เมื่อเจ้าหน้าที่คัดลอกและวางข้อมูลในการดำเนินการต่างๆ

แมโครคือชุดของการดำเนินการตามลำดับที่ผู้ใช้ดำเนินการ ช่วยให้ผู้ใช้สามารถดำเนินการประจำวันได้อย่างมีประสิทธิภาพอย่างรวดเร็วและสอดคล้องกับกระบวนการ คุณสามารถใช้แมโครซ้ำด้วยเซสชันต่างๆ ได้ โดยขึ้นอยู่กับพารามิเตอร์บริบทที่เฉพาะเจาะจงสำหรับเซสชัน

ข้อกำหนดเบื้องต้น

  • ตรวจสอบให้แน่ใจว่าคุณมีบทบาทความปลอดภัย ผู้ดูแลระบบเครื่องมือเพิ่มประสิทธิภาพการทำงาน หรือ ผู้ดูแลระบบ ในการออกแบบแมโคร

  • ตรวจสอบให้แน่ใจว่าเจ้าหน้าที่และหัวหน้างานได้รับกำหนดบทบาทความปลอดภัย ผู้ใช้เครื่องมือเพิ่มประสิทธิภาพการทำงาน หรือ เจ้าหน้าที่บริการลูกค้า

ข้อมูลเพิ่มเติม: กำหนดบทบาทและเปิดใช้งานผู้ใช้

สร้างแมโคร

ดำเนินการขั้นตอนต่อไปนี้เพื่อสร้างแมโครในศูนย์การจัดการ Customer Service

  1. ไปที่ การเพิ่มประสิทธิภาพการทำงาน ใน ประสบการณ์เจ้าหน้าที่
  2. เลือก จัดการ สำหรับ แมโคร
  3. เลือก ใหม่
  4. ในหน้า แมโคร ให้ระบุชื่อและคำอธิบายสำหรับแมโคร

ตรวจสอบให้แน่ใจว่าคุณเริ่มสร้างแมโครด้วยขั้นตอน เริ่มดำเนินการแมโคร เสมอ

ทริกเกอร์แมโคร

การดำเนินการต่อไปนี้สามารถทริกเกอร์แมโครได้:

  • เจ้าหน้าที่สามารถเรียกใช้ แมโคร จากบานหน้าต่าง การเพิ่มประสิทธิภาพการทำงาน ในแอป Customer Service workspace
  • การเรียก API

การดำเนินการระบบอัตโนมัติที่กำหนดไว้ล่วงหน้า

คุณสามารถใช้การดำเนินการของระบบอัตโนมัติที่กำหนดค่าล่วงหน้าเพื่อสร้างแมโคร:

  • ระบบอัตโนมัติของประสิทธิภาพการทำงาน: จัดให้มีการดำเนินการต่างๆ สำหรับการดำเนินการแอปแบบจำลอง คุณสามารถใช้การดำเนินการเหล่านี้เพื่อทำให้งานต่อไปนี้เป็นอัตโนมัติ:

  • เปิดและอัปเดตเรกคอร์ด

  • เปิดมุมมอง

  • แก้ไขกรณี

  • ค้นหาฐานข้อมูลองค์ความรู้

  • ลอกแบบเรกคอร์ด

  • ตั้งโฟกัสไปที่สคริปต์สำหรับเจ้าหน้าที่อื่น

  • เปิดเทมเพลตอีเมล

  • เติมข้อมูลในฟิลด์ของฟอร์มอัตโนมัติ

  • ตั้งค่าและดึงข้อมูลตัวแปรและค่าในบริบทเซสชัน

  • ตัวเชื่อมต่อเซสชัน: จัดเตรียมการดำเนินการเพื่อทำการดำเนินการที่เกี่ยวข้องกับเซสชัน คุณสามารถใช้การดำเนินการเหล่านี้เพื่อรับรหัสของแท็บ รีเฟรชแท็บ ส่งรหัสแท็บ ตั้งโฟกัสไปที่แท็บตามรหัสแท็บ เปิดเทมเพลตแท็บ และรีเฟรชบริบทของเซสชัน

  • ตัวเชื่อมต่อช่องทาง Omni: จัดเตรียมการดำเนินการเพื่อดำเนินการช่องทาง Omni สำหรับ Customer Service ที่เกี่ยวข้องกับการดำเนินการ แมโครตัวเชื่อมต่อช่องทาง Omni ช่วยให้คุณสามารถเชื่อมโยงและยกเลิกการเชื่อมโยงเรกคอร์ดกับการสนทนา

  • ตัวเชื่อมต่อโฟลว์: ช่วยให้คุณสามารถทริกเกอร์โฟลว์ Power Automate

ส่งผ่านตัวแปรบริบทของเซสชันไปยังแมโคร

ในแมโคร คุณสามารถส่งค่าไดนามิก เช่น ชื่อลูกค้าหรือรหัสลูกค้าเป็นพารามิเตอร์ไปยังแมโครได้ ข้อมูลจะถูกจัดเก็บไว้ในบริบทเซสชันเป็นคู่คีย์-ค่า ตัวแปรบริบทของเซสชันเรียกอีกอย่างว่า slug

เมื่อเจ้าหน้าที่เปิดกรณี การสนทนา หรือแท็บอื่นในเซสชัน บริบทของเซสชันจะถูกเติมดังนี้:

  • กรณี: กรณีนี้คือแท็บจุดยึดหรือแท็บแรกของเซสชัน บริบทเซสชันถูกเติมด้วยแอตทริบิวต์และค่าจากเรกคอร์ดกรณีและถูกเก็บไว้ในหน่วยความจำเบราว์เซอร์ ตัวอย่างของตัวแปรบริบทเซสชันที่เติมจากเรกคอร์ดกรณีมีดังต่อไปนี้:

    ${anchor.incidentid}: 6194b723-7e5f-eb11-a812-000d3a1a658a
    ${anchor.ticketnumber}: CAS-47732-V4V6K6
    ${anchor.title}: แร่ธาตุที่สะสมอยู่ในแหล่งน้ำ
    ${anchor.createdon}: 2022-12-14T23:03:24Z
    ${anchor.prioritycode}: 2
    ${anchor.prioritycode@OData.Community.Display.V1.FormattedValue}: ปกติ
    ${anchor._customerid_value}: f5973462-768e-eb11-b1ac-000d3ae92b46
    ${anchor._customerid_value@Microsoft.Dynamics.CRM.lookuplogicalname}: บุคคลสำหรับติดต่อ
    ${anchor._customerid_value@OData.Community.Display.V1.FormattedValue}: Claudia Mazzanti

    หมายเหตุ

    บริบทของเซสชันจะเติมค่าจากแท็บจุดยึดเท่านั้น

คุณยังสามารถดึงค่าจากเรกคอร์ดที่เกี่ยวข้องได้โดยใช้การสอบถาม oData ตัวอย่างเช่น คุณสามารถใช้การสอบถาม oData ต่อไปนี้เพื่อดึงที่อยู่อีเมลจากเรกคอร์ดลูกค้าในกรณี: ${$odata.contact.emailaddress1.?$filter=contactid eq '{anchor._customerid_value}'}

  • การสนทนา: บริบทเซสชันถูกเติมด้วยแอตทริบิวต์การสนทนาจากผู้ให้บริการช่องทางและถูกเก็บไว้ในแคชของเบราว์เซอร์ ตัวอย่างเช่น ตัวแปรบริบทของเซสชันจะถูกเติมดังนี้สำหรับการสนทนาของแชทขาเข้า:

    ${Email} : claudiamazzanti@crmdemo.dynamics.com${LiveWorkItemId} : 57e4323e-a93f-4c30-b8e8-b075ab5d71cc
    ${customerEntityName} : บุคคลสำหรับติดต่อ
    ${customerName} : Claudia Mazzanti
    ${customerRecordId} : f5973462-768e-eb11-b1ac-000d3ae92b46
    ${queueId}: 6b189e87-e09b-eb11-b1ac-000d3af4e3f9
    ${visitorLanguage} : en-us

คุณยังสามารถดึงค่าจากเรกคอร์ดที่เกี่ยวข้องได้โดยใช้การสอบถาม oData ตัวอย่างเช่น คุณสามารถดึงที่อยู่อีเมลจากเรกคอร์ดลูกค้าในกรณีด้วยการสอบถามนี้ ${$odata.contact.emailaddress1.?$filter=contactid eq '{customerRecordId}'}

  • แท็บเพิ่มเติม: เรกคอร์ดที่เปิดในแท็บเพิ่มเติมของเซสชันเดียวกันจะไม่ใช้ในบริบทของเซสชัน อย่างไรก็ตาม คุณสามารถเข้าถึงชื่อของเอนทิตีและรหัสเรกคอร์ดเอนทิตีได้ดังต่อไปนี้:

    ${Session.CurrentTab.entityId} : 0e8642d7-c2ae-ea11-a812-000d3a1b14a2 ${Session.CurrentTab.entityName} : บัญชีที่มีรหัสเอนทิตี คุณสามารถดึงค่าอื่นๆ ในเรกคอร์ดผ่านการสอบถาม oData ต่อไปนี้ ${$odata.account.name.?$filter=accountid eq '{Session.CurrentTab.entityId}'}

ขั้นตอนถัดไป

ใช้ระบบอัตโนมัติการเพิ่มประสิทธิภาพการทำงานเพื่อสร้างแมโคร
ใช้ตัวเชื่อมต่อเซสชันเพื่อสร้างแมโคร
ใช้ตัวเชื่อมต่อช่องทาง omni เพื่อสร้างแมโคร
ตัวเชื่อมต่อโฟลว์

ดูเพิ่มเติม

ใช้พจนานุกรมอัตโนมัติเพื่อส่งผ่านข้อมูลพารามิเตอร์หลัก
สคริปต์สำหรับเจ้าหน้าที่
ระบบช่วยเหลืออัจฉริยะ